Transaction d22c251017c26f9c9be1884c7736622aad09b96353621f0714919b57b3467f69
1 Input
2 Outputs
- d22c251017c26f9c9be1884c7736622aad09b96353621f0714919b57b3467f69:0
- d22c251017c26f9c9be1884c7736622aad09b96353621f0714919b57b3467f69:1
value 10000000
address 3QMUFxVa95ipFvWKihKa8SqbCpWAMpXy5r
value 25567832
address 14h8pnvkPqwrtdvzjVXG1kUX5JWCUYjTTw